Team Placements

The Association will strive to place 8-12 players per team.  While not ideal, participation numbers may necessitate smaller or larger teams.  

3rd-grade players will be divided equally into teams.

4th-8th grade players will be placed on appropriate teams based on their tryout performance, previous season player evaluations, attitude, coachability, and commitment to the game of basketball.  Players are not placed on teams based upon coaching availability.  Tryouts are closed to parents.  

Players may be moved to different teams following the first few weeks of practice to secure the best placement and success of each individual player.

Practice:

Practices will start at the end of October.  Practice schedules will be shared through the SportsEngine app and will be listed on our website.  We share and coordinate gym space with multiple other sports and organizations.  For this reason, we may only have a practice schedule available week by week.  Typically, practices will occur on Monday, Tuesday, and Thursday evenings, as well as Saturday mornings.  Occasionally there may be a Friday evening or Saturday afternoon practice.  

Tournaments:

Tournament play will start in mid-November and conclude by early March, and will vary by team and grade level.  The tournament schedule will be communicated via the SportsEngine app and our website once the season has started.  Tournaments are held on weekends.  Most of the tournaments are held on one-day, but will be listed as 2 day event in the tournament schedule.  We generally receive the tournament schedule and information within 1 week of the tournament date.  Coaches will communicate any tournament details or release information in the SportsEngine app or via email.

Volunteering:

Parents are asked to do volunteer hours at our home tournament in January.  The number of hours required will fluctuate each year but is generally 3-4 hours per family.  Our home tournament is our main fundraising source.  Volunteer hours include set up, concessions, clock, book, and clean up.  Families that do not fulfill their volunteer hours during the tournament will be assessed a $100 fee per hour.
